This patch adds a unique ID to avfoundation devices. This is needed
because device index can change while the machine is running when
devices are plugged or unplugged and device names can be tricky to use
with localization and etc.
Example of output:
./ffmpeg -f avfoundation -list_devices true -i ""
[...]
[AVFoundation indev @ 0x158705230] AVFoundation video devices:
[AVFoundation indev @ 0x158705230] [0] FaceTime HD Camera (ID:
47B4B64B70674B9CAD2BAE273A71F4B5)
[AVFoundation indev @ 0x158705230] [1] Capture screen 0 (ID:
AvfilterAvfoundationCaptureScreen1)
[AVFoundation indev @ 0x158705230] AVFoundation audio devices:
[AVFoundation indev @ 0x158705230] [0] Loopback Audio (ID:
com.rogueamoeba.Loopback.A5668B36-711E-4DF5-8A8D-7148508C735B)
[AVFoundation indev @ 0x158705230] [1] MacBook Pro Microphone (ID:
BuiltInMicrophoneDevice)
Notes:
* Unique names do not seem to follow any specific pattern. I have used
one similar to the builtin microphone for screen capture
* The : substitution is actually required. The loopback device above
did
have it in its name.
Is there no way to escape the : in the command so that we would not
need to mess with the ID the system gives us?
And if we need to, it would be ideal to have a fully reversible way of
doing so, as then you could just reverse the mangling and use
`deviceWithUniqueID:` instead of iterating all devices.
That said, if thats not easily doable I am fine with the patch as-is,
aside from the minor comments below, thanks for your work on this.
